Overview
Walla Walla Community College is seeking a Social Media and Content Specialist to support the college’s mission of access, opportunity, and community impact. The role involves creating and managing social media content that promotes programs, highlights community partnerships, and supports enrollment and retention goals.

Responsibilities

Expand access and awareness by promoting programs, financial aid, and flexible learning options through targeted social content.

Strengthen community connection by showcasing partnerships, local impact, and student success stories.

Support enrollment and retention through strategic content that guides prospective students from interest to enrollment.

Humanize the college experience via storytelling that includes faculty features, student journeys, and classroom moments.

Ensure brand clarity and trust through consistent, accurate, and on‑brand messaging.

Amplify institutional priorities, such as new programs and workforce pathways, across appropriate channels.

Essential Functions

Develop and write brand‑aligned content for platforms such as Facebook, Instagram, TikTok, and other emerging channels.

Plan, create, and schedule engaging posts, including captions and messaging.

Produce photo and video content that highlights students, programs, faculty, and campus life.

Collaborate with marketing teams and other departments to gather timely content and align with campaigns and goals.

Create performance reports, track analytics, and use data to refine content strategy.
